The median home value in Horseshoe Bay, TX is $489,100. According to Zillow, the home value index for Horseshoe Bay is $704,804. The median rent is $1,575 per month (Census ACS). About 83.8% of housing units are owner-occupied. The median year homes were built is 1994. There are 3,801 total housing units.
